      @@MannsModelMoments 16:56 On the left side there are two closed windows. On the finished model, they look as if they were patched up from the inside with some kind of piece. After all, on a real helicopter, these were whole panels. All this needs to be puttied, rubbed and applied rivet rows.

      @@siberianmodeller No, they weren't whole panels on the real thing. We got to look around the Sea Kings on site, and these airframes were modified over time and patched up with riveted panels all over. Especially in this case, where it is a siingle aircraft modified over time (and many were, don't forget), this WAS "patched up" on the real thing. I think many modellers assume these things are a lot "neater" than they really are, which is why research is so important - Airfix have put 2 years of research into this kit, and believe me, this is correct
